Hounsome Fields is a residential area in Hampshire with a population of 2,296. The median property price is £422,500, with 38 sales recorded in the 12 months to May 2026. Detached homes median at £542,500, semi-detached at £396,750, and terraced at £345,000.

Energy efficiency is strong: 85.4% of properties are rated band C or better. Air quality is low for nitrogen dioxide and moderate for particulate matter. Flood risk is absent. Primary and junior education is served by North Waltham Primary School, with secondary provision at Brighton Hill Community School. The area benefits from good broadband coverage, with 84.4% superfast availability. Deprivation is relatively moderate; about 75% of neighbourhoods in England are more deprived. The area falls within Basingstoke and Deane, governed by a council with no overall control. Council tax for band D is £2,224.83.
